Do Antibiotics Cause Tinnitus

Tinnitus, commonly known as ringing in the ears, affects millions of people worldwide. While the causes of tinnitus can vary, there is growing evidence to suggest that antibiotics may play a role in its development. Antibiotics are powerful medications used to treat bacterial infections, but they can also have damaging effects on your hearing health. Understanding the link between antibiotics and tinnitus is crucial for protecting your auditory system.

The Link Between Antibiotics and Tinnitus

Research has shown that certain classes of antibiotics, such as aminoglycosides and macrolides, can cause damage to the delicate hair cells in the inner ear. These hair cells are responsible for converting sound waves into electrical signals that are sent to the brain for interpretation. When these cells are damaged, it can result in symptoms like tinnitus or even hearing loss. Additionally, some antibiotics have been found to have ototoxic effects, meaning they are toxic to the ear and can lead to auditory problems.

The Damaging Effects of Antibiotics on Your Hearing

The damaging effects of antibiotics on your hearing can be long-lasting and even permanent in some cases. In addition to tinnitus, antibiotics can also cause symptoms such as dizziness, vertigo, and imbalance. This can significantly impact your quality of life and overall well-being. It is important to be aware of the potential risks associated with antibiotic use and to discuss any concerns with your healthcare provider.
